plus Abstract :

My PhD deals with the classification of very high resolution SAR images of urban areas, as a support to multi-risk monitoring of these environments. (e.g. flooding, earthquake...)

The classification is obtained by combining a statistical modeling of VHR amplitude SAR data - which uses a dictionary-based mixture probability density function (PDF) estimation approach - with a Markov random field (MRF) model, thus allowing to take into account the contextual information.
The algorithm robustness has been increased thanks to the introduction of textural features extracted from the original SAR images.
An improvement of this algorithm is obtained by using more complete MRFs such as hierarchical MRFs.

This PhD is in collaboration with the University of Genoa (Italy).
